Anyone else notice:
SEC Championship Game 4:00 pm
ACC Championship Game 8:00 pm
Big Ten Championship Game 8:00 pm
Oklahoma/Okie State game, winner is Big XII Champion 8:00 pm
I understand the want to have the SEC title game on at a separate time, in that, this game has so much riding on the National Championship.
I do not get pitting the other Championship Games into the same time slot. This divides up the ratings.
Everybody wants a prime-time game; and yet, they will be in direct confrontation for viewership.
